## ProfileVault Environments

ProfileVault shards the user-profile store across four partitions in staging and sixteen in production. Shard assignment is hash-based on account ID, so rebalancing only happens during planned resharding windows. If you're on call and see hot-shard alerts, check the partition map before touching anything — most pages resolve to a single overloaded shard. The active shard configuration for production is as follows.

settings of hahag-taweg:
[jorius]
team = gilox
access_code = ac_b64218
host = jorius.zarqelstack.example
port = 8080
owner = quenath.briax
peer = eliix.halixcloud.corp

GuideTone audio-guide app, Hallwick Museum build. If streaming stalls, restart the media worker before touching the CDN config. Config lives in /opt/guidetone/.env on both app nodes. After rotating credentials in the Tessira console, update the signing secret in that file, placing it on the line immediately following this sentence.

secret setting of yagef-baweg: RELAY_SECRET29=cb53deb59a49ed54d9f43599b54ca

### Runbook: Pagination Abuse — Finchline Public API

Security review context: the Finchline REST API uses opaque cursor pagination; cursors are HMAC-signed and expire after 15 minutes. Offset-style parameters are rejected outright to prevent enumeration. If you see clients walking sequential cursors at high rate, check the abuse dashboard before blocking — some partners legitimately backfill. Tampered cursors return 400 and are logged with the signing-key generation. All cursor validation failures carry the trace token shown below.

pipeline stamp: htk31_f769b577b3028a4e9958e5bb8d1259a

The theme-preview service that renders dark-mode variants of the Helmsboard admin screens stopped responding yesterday; investigation shows the service credential used by the preview worker expired at rotation and was never renewed. Until it is replaced, reviewers cannot validate the contrast fixes in the pending dark-mode branch, so please hold approval on that changeset. I have provisioned a fresh credential with identical scopes, verified against staging. The replacement key is included directly below for the worker config.

API key for yahig-tadup: kto7_ubizbYm